Blood volume increases significantly to support the growing fetus, placing extra demand on the mother's circulatory system. Adequate fluid intake helps prevent common discomforts such as constipation, urinary tract infections, and swelling in the hands and feet.

Flavoring water naturally with slices of cucumber, lemon, or mint can enhance appeal without adding sugar, making the act of drinking more enjoyable and encouraging adherence to hydration targets. Carrying a reusable water bottle allows for sips throughout the day, while setting small hourly goals can prevent the feeling of being overwhelmed by large quantities.
